What Is Fit-Out Flooring?

Fit-out flooring is the flooring scope inside a multi-trade fit-out programme, covering Cat A shell-and-core handover (base finishes by the developer or landlord) and Cat B tenant fit-out (custom branded interiors by the occupier). It runs sequenced with MEP, ceiling, partition and joinery trades to land before FF&E delivery. The flooring contractor inside that programme reads it as a trade partner, not as a standalone install.

What separates fit-out flooring from one-off install is the coordination layer. The flooring trade sequences with the M&E team, the ceiling and partition contractor, the joinery sub, and the snagging schedule. Material selection, subfloor handover timing, install windows and snagging tolerance are all worked against the wider programme. The trade who reads the programme correctly lands their week; the trade who does not holds up FF&E delivery and pushes the soft-opening date.

UAE-specific factors define the scale. Fit-out programmes in Dubai and Abu Dhabi run on tight lease-commencement and soft-opening deadlines, with main contractors managing 8 to 15 trades simultaneously across office, retail, hospitality, healthcare, education and industrial projects. The flooring trade partner who reads the programme, lands their week, attends snagging and clears defects in time for FF&E delivery is the one main contractors invite back to the next tender.

Cat A and Cat B Flooring Explained

Cat A and Cat B are the two procurement layers of UAE commercial fit-out. Cat A is the developer or landlord's base finishes, the leasable platform delivered at shell-and-core handover. Cat B is the tenant's branded interior, layered on top of the Cat A floor. Different scope, different procurement route, different flooring decisions. Most UAE commercial fit-outs run both, with the Cat A layer delivered by the building owner and the Cat B layer by the tenant.

Procurement Layer 1

Cat A , Shell-and-Core Base Finishes

Delivered by the developer or landlord to provide a leasable base. Typical Cat A flooring is polished concrete across large floor plates, basic commercial-grade LVT in lobbies and corridors, and painted line markings in back-of-house and parking. The Cat A floor is the surface the tenant inherits at handover, the platform for the Cat B fit-out that follows.

Procurement Layer 2

Cat B , Tenant Fit-Out

The tenant's branded interior specification, layered onto the Cat A handover. Typical Cat B flooring is branded LVT or premium carpet tiles in workstations, point-of-sale flooring in retail, hospitality-grade carpet in hotel guest rooms, raised access in modern offices, safety vinyl in F&B back-of-house and healthcare wet zones.

Fit-Out Flooring by Sector

Different sectors carry different fit-out flooring scopes. We deliver the flooring trade scope inside fit-out programmes across the six sector types UAE fit-out contractors run most often. For full sector depth, follow the links below.

Healthcare Fit-Out Flooring

Heat-welded sheet vinyl with flash coving in clinical zones, safety vinyl in wet zones, seamless resin in laboratories. Specified to align with MOHAP, DHA and DOH requirements, with the documentation prepared for the facility's licensing file.

How We Deliver Inside a Fit-Out Programme

Fit-out main contractors evaluate trade partners against a procurement checklist that has nothing to do with material brochures. Seven disciplines define how we work inside someone else's programme.

Tender Response and BOQ Pricing

We price BOQs clearly against the specification, with material grade, install method and exclusions itemised line by line, so the main contractor can compare like for like and brief their cost consultant accurately.

Programme Reading

We work from the main contractor's programme, sequence our scope against MEP, ceiling, partition and joinery trades, and flag our access and subfloor handover requirements at quote rather than mid-project.

RAMS and Method Statements

Risk Assessment, Method Statement, COSHH and MSDS submitted ahead of mobilisation, prepared to the format and review cycle the main contractor's HSE team works to.

Subfloor Handover Sequencing

We receive the subfloor at the agreed point in programme, verify condition against tolerance, and document preparation requirements before install rather than after defects appear.

Multi-Trade Coordination on Site

Daily site-management communication, conflict flagging early, scope landed inside the agreed window. The trade who manages this well saves the main contractor more than the cost of the floor.

Snagging Discipline

We attend snagging walks, action defects to the snagging tolerance, and provide warranty documentation at handover rather than chasing it through the closeout phase.

Authority Approval Support

Civil Defence and any sector-specific authority documentation prepared inside our scope and handed across to the main contractor's authority team in submission-ready form.

Frequently Asked Questions About Fit-Out Flooring

What is the difference between Cat A and Cat B flooring?

Cat A is the developer or landlord's base flooring delivered at shell-and-core handover, typically polished concrete or basic LVT across the leasable space. Cat B is the tenant's branded fit-out flooring layered on top, with material specification matched to the brand. Most UAE commercial fit-outs run both layers, delivered by different parties.

How much does fit-out flooring cost in the UAE?

Fit-out flooring cost depends on the sector, the Cat A vs Cat B layer and the materials specified across zones. Cat A polished concrete starts from around AED 45 per square metre (sqm), about AED 4.20 per sqft, while branded Cat B specifications across hospitality and healthcare reach higher.
